Summary
Fibrous dysplasia (FD) of bone is a rare congenital condition where fibrous tissue replaces normal bone, causing deformities. Craniofacial FD presents unique challenges in diagnosis and treatment, requiring multidisciplinary management.
Area of Science:
- Medical Sciences
- Pathology
- Genetics
Background:
- Fibrous dysplasia (FD) of bone is a rare, benign congenital disorder characterized by the replacement of normal bone with fibrous tissue.
- This pathological process can lead to significant bone deformities, affecting any bone in the body.
- Craniofacial fibrous dysplasia (cFD) presents distinct clinical manifestations, progression patterns, and therapeutic challenges compared to FD in other skeletal sites.
Observation:
- This study retrospectively analyzed six patients with craniofacial FD treated at the Principal Hospital of Dakar.
- The patient cohort had an average age of 26.16 years (range: 11–58 years), with a strong female predominance (83%).
- The primary clinical presentation leading to diagnosis was bone deformity, with one patient experiencing unilateral nasal obstruction and epistaxis.
Findings:
- Computed tomography (CT) scans were instrumental in diagnosing craniofacial FD and assessing its topographic extent in all patients.
- Surgical intervention was performed in two female patients.
- A single case of recurrence was documented within the study group.
Implications:
- Craniofacial FD is a rare condition with the potential to cause severe sensory and functional impairments.
- Effective management of cFD necessitates a comprehensive, interdisciplinary approach due to its complex therapeutic landscape.
- Further research into the pathogenesis and long-term outcomes of cFD is warranted to optimize patient care.

The human skull is composed of several bones that come together to protect the brain and support the structures of the face. The junctions where these bones meet are called sutures.
Sutures are immobile joints between adjacent bones of the skull. The narrow gap between the bones is filled with dense, fibrous connective tissue that unites the bones. The cranium (skull) is the skeletal structure of the head that supports the face and protects the brain. It is subdivided into the facial bones and the brain case, or cranial vault. The facial bones underlie the facial structures, form the nasal cavity, enclose the eyeballs, and support the teeth of the upper and lower jaws.

Fibrous joints are a type of joint where the bones are connected by fibrous connective tissue. These joints provide stability and minimal to no movement between the articulating bones. There are three types of fibrous joints.
